HAZMAT FLATBED TRANSPORT DRIVER (SACRAMENTO, CA) We are looking for local and regional flatbed transport drivers to join our small, “family first” company, who are committed to getting the job done safely and efficiently. This full-time position features local and regional driving opportunities primarily within 350-400 miles of Sacramento, CA. Humboldt Pacific, LLC is a fuel transport company specializing in the safe and efficient delivery of bulk fuel—including Jet A, JP8, AVGAS, and kerosene—as well as other petroleum commodities. In addition to our fuel transport services, we provide comprehensive flatbed transportation solutions for both hazmat and non-hazmat loads throughout California, Nevada, and Oregon. Our flatbed division is equipped to handle a diverse range of freight, including hazardous materials that require strict regulatory compliance and specialized handling. We ensure all hazmat loads are transported in accordance with federal and state regulations, with properly trained drivers, certified equipment, and rigorous safety protocols. For non-hazmat shipments, we offer reliable transport of oversized, heavy, or specialized cargo such as equipment, machinery, and materials requiring securement and careful coordination. Our team is experienced in load planning, securement, and route compliance, ensuring every shipment is delivered safely, efficiently, and on schedule. Requirements

  • Must hold a valid Class A CDL with TWIC, HAZMAT.
  • A Tank Endorsement is also preferred.
  • Minimum of 24 months commercial driving experience
  • No more than 2 major moving violations within a 3 year period
  • No more than 2 accidents within a 3 year period
  • DOT Drug Screening required
  • No Felony convictions
  • No DUI's/ DWI's within the last 7 years
  • No positive or refused drug or alcohol tests
  • Current Medical Examiner's Certificate
  • Must be 23 Years of age or older
  • Ability to conduct all operations in a safe manner
  • Must be legally authorized to work in the U.S. on a regular, full-time basis without restrictions
  • Must be able to speak, read, write, and comprehend the English language.

Responsibilities

  • Transports deliveries in a safe, responsible manner and in accordance with company policy and applicable State & Federal regulations.
  • Applies knowledge and abilities to safely load and unload deliveries according to the capacity of the load and content description.
  • Processes and maintains proper delivery authorization and pickup documentation and submits in a timely manner.
  • Maintains communication with dispatch as to any delays or issues during route/shift.
  • Provides good customer service and maintains a professional manner and appearance to enhance the company’s image.
  • Performs a daily DOT pre-trip and post-trip inspection checklist, informing maintenance personnel of any issues.
  • Maintains a daily, legible DOT log book and submits logbooks as required by company policy.
  • Maintains vehicle in a neat and tidy manner.
  • Reports all accidents/damages/malfunctions immediately to management as per company policy and procedure.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.
